A Kakuro puzzle resembles a crossword puzzle, but with numbers. You have 'across' and 'down' clues, but instead of filling in letters, you must use the numbers 1-9. The aim of the game is to fill each blank square with a number from 1 to 9 to sum up to the clue associated with it. However, no number can be duplicated in an entry. For example a clue of 8 (over 2 squares) could be 1&7, 3&5, but not 4&4.
